What is one of the purposes of close order drill?

One of the primary purposes of close order drill is to instill discipline among service members. Through the repetitive actions and commands involved in close order drill, Marines learn to respond promptly and accurately, fostering a sense of obedience and respect for authority. This discipline is crucial for maintaining order in various situations, especially in combat scenarios where quick, coordinated movements can be vital to mission success. The structured environment of close order drill helps develop habits of precision, uniformity, and teamwork, which are essential values in a military setting, ultimately enhancing unit cohesion and effectiveness.
